The following are some names commonly used by boys, some of which were chosen for you according to your requirements.

Alessandro comes from Greece, which means being able to defend and protect.

Alessio comes from Greece, which means to be able to defend and protect.

Andrea is from Greece, which means brave.

Aurelio comes from Latin, which means dazzling

Ernesto comes from German, which means brave and strong.

Francisco comes from German, which means freedom.

Franco comes from German, which means freedom.

Gabriele comes from Jewish, which means hero of God.

Guglielmo comes from German, which means strong will.

Luigi comes from German, which means brave and glorious soldier.

Riccardo comes from German, which means bold and powerful.

Salvatore comes from Latin, which means savior.

Sergio is from Greece, which means guardian.

Valentino comes from Latin, which means strong and healthy.

Valerio comes from Latin, which means strong, strong.

Vincenzo comes from Latin, which means victory.

Virgilio comes from Latin, which means guardian.

Vittorio comes from Latin, which means winner.
